摘要

Using GIS to analysis urban water supply pipeline network characteristic, it can make full use of GIS spatial data management and graphics processing advantages. This paper is on the basis of clarified the importance of the dynamic characteristics, it include three aspects of research. First, topological graph modeling, establishes the section between the nodes and directed graph, and uses adjacency list to store; Second, spatial database structure, it designed by the topography and galleries, some data sets, the line data set, the surface data and document data sets of pipe network GIS spatial data structure; Third, nodal flow dynamic characteristics, analysis of node flow of small changes, which can lead to node pressure and the change in the flow section, and build the mathematical model. In this paper, the research contents to ensure the security of urban water supply, improve the level of urban management information, improve emergency management capability of urban is of great significance.
